Why an Electric Can Opener is a Game-Changer
While a manual opener gets the job done, an automatic can opener offers distinct advantages that go beyond mere convenience. The primary benefit is accessibility. By removing the need for significant hand strength or dexterity, these devices empower seniors and individuals with conditions like arthritis, carpal tunnel, or Parkinson’s disease to maintain independence in the kitchen. A simple press of a button initiates a smooth, hands-free opening process.
Safety and Consistency: Electric openers typically leave a smooth, safe edge on the lid and the can, drastically reducing the risk of cuts from sharp, jagged metal. This is a critical feature for anyone concerned about safety. Furthermore, they offer remarkable consistency. No more half-opened cans or struggling with alignment; a good model reliably completes the task the same way every time.
Key Features to Look For
Not all electric can openers are created equal. Knowing what features to prioritize will ensure you choose the best tool for your specific needs.
Magnet vs. Manual Lid Removal: Many premium models feature a built-in magnet that lifts and holds the cut lid after opening. This is a fantastic feature, as it keeps the lid from falling into the food and allows for easy disposal without touching the sharp edge. Models without this require you to manually remove the lid, which can be a drawback.
Power Source and Design: Most home kitchen models are corded, providing consistent power. Consider the footprint and where it will live on your counter. A compact, low-profile design with a non-slip base is ideal. Also, look for easy-to-clean surfaces. Some advanced models even function as multi-tools, offering additional features like a bottle opener or knife sharpener.
Safety and Practical Usage Tips
While electric openers are designed for safety, following best practices ensures trouble-free operation for years.
Secure Placement is Crucial: Always place the opener on a stable, flat, and dry surface before use. Ensure the power cord is tucked away to prevent tripping or pulling the unit off the counter. According to manufacturer guidelines, never attempt to open a can that is severely dented or damaged.
Cleaning and Maintenance: Most units have a removable cutting assembly that should be cleaned regularly to prevent food buildup and bacterial growth. Always unplug the device before cleaning. Wipe down the exterior with a damp cloth—never submerge the motor housing in water. In our testing, a well-maintained opener performs more reliably and lasts significantly longer.
Top Considerations for Seniors and Accessibility
When selecting an opener for someone with limited hand strength or mobility, specific design elements become paramount.
Large, Easy-to-Press Buttons: Look for models with oversized, tactile buttons that require minimal pressure to activate. Rocker switches or single large buttons are often easier to use than small, recessed ones.
Lightweight and Easy to Handle: The unit itself shouldn’t be heavy or cumbersome to move from storage to counter. A lightweight design with comfortable grips is a plus. The most accessible models automate the entire process: you place the can, press the button, and retrieve it when the magnet holds the lid—minimizing handling and effort.
